 Barely six months after its acquisition of Cats Software, Midas-Kapiti International (MKI) has replaced two senior MKI risk executives running the company with officials from corporate MKI. David Gilbert, chief executive, and David Samuels, vice president, have been let go by MKI chairman Rupert Soames.
